This 234.2-mile drive from Evansville, IN to Gas City, IN is a straightforward, single-day trip, taking about 4 hours and 28 minutes. It's a heavily highway-focused route, with 97% of the journey on major roads like I-69 and SR 37, making it a quick transit through the Midwest. With an estimated fuel cost of $37, this trip is budget-friendly for a day excursion. You'll encounter one designated stop along the way, but otherwise, the focus is on covering ground efficiently. Consider this route for its simplicity and directness when you need to get from point A to point B within Indiana.

Expect a predominantly highway-focused experience on this journey. The drive is characterized by 97% highway travel, primarily on I-69 and SR 37. This means you'll be on high-speed roads for the vast majority of your trip, with the longest uninterrupted stretch covering an impressive 178.4 miles on I-69. The route is designed for efficiency, so anticipate smooth, consistent driving conditions without many significant changes in road type or speed.
This is a straightforward highway drive that stays mostly on I 69 and SR 37. You will hit about 16 points where you need to pay attention to lane position or signs. The trickiest moment comes around 0.1 miles in near East Walnut Street.
Moderate - straightforward overall, but long enough or busy enough to require pacing
This drive requires moderate attention. Across 234.2 miles you will encounter 16 spots where lane choice or exit timing matters. Not difficult for experienced highway drivers, but worth previewing the tricky sections before you go.
